Poetry: Vampires

by Christine Hutson

Created on: May 21, 2009

Seven a.m.

Here comes the cart

Visiting hours have not begun

Feeding time not yet done

Chained in the basement

I V fed

Things have changed

For the living dead

Time was

He roamed the night

Causing people terrible fright

Science eased that awful plight

So get your bed bath

They collect his dues

He gives back

Health wise news

Computers come

Computers go

The vampire is

A diagnostic pro
